Abstract
We present a model for color vision system with learning capabilities. The system adapts to statistical properties of its input. The adaptation is done by utilizing unsupervised learning techniques, as Self-organizing feature maps(1) and vectorial boundary adaptation maps.(2) A color difference reflecting statistical properties of input to the system is defined. The model was tested by using color data with different statistics and two different sets of rhodopsin-based color sensors.
